Biography
Mayim Chaya Bialik, born on December 12, 1975, is a multi-talented American actress, game show host, neuroscientist, and author. She first captured audiences' hearts with her role as the endearing title character in the NBC sitcom "Blossom" in the early 1990s. Bialik's versatility as an actress shone through as she effortlessly transitioned from her child star days to her iconic portrayal of neuroscientist Amy Farrah Fowler on the hit CBS sitcom "The Big Bang Theory."
Bialik's early career showcased her talent and range, from her role in the horror film "Pumpkinhead" to her captivating performance as young CC Bloom in "Beaches" alongside Bette Midler. Her dedication to her craft was evident in her work on various television shows and films, earning her critical acclaim and a loyal fan base.
In addition to her acting career, Bialik's passion for neuroscience led her to pursue a doctorate in the field, a remarkable achievement that set her apart in Hollywood. This dedication to education and her intellect brought authenticity to her portrayal of a neurobiologist on "The Big Bang Theory," earning her multiple Emmy Award nominations for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Comedy Series.
Beyond her acting prowess, Bialik's creativity and entrepreneurial spirit led her to establish Sad Clown Productions, a production company that has collaborated with industry giants like Warner Bros. Entertainment and Jim Parsons's That's Wonderful Productions. Together, they brought to life the sitcom "Call Me Kat," a project that showcased Bialik's talent both in front of and behind the camera.
In 2021, Bialik took on the role of a guest host on the iconic game show "Jeopardy!," showcasing her charisma and intelligence to audiences worldwide. Her success in this role led to the announcement that she would host future primetime specials and spinoffs of the show, culminating in her becoming one of the permanent hosts in a groundbreaking job-sharing arrangement alongside fellow host Ken Jennings.
